For brave men and women who have worn the uniform, navigating civilian life after the military can come with its share of challenges. Whether it’s exploring health support, seeking monetary assistance, or making sure loved ones are looked after, the journey often demands both direction and understanding.

One of the most important aspects of post-service life is understanding the benefits and assistance available to former military personnel. From medical services to living arrangements and beyond, veterans have secured access to a wide array of support programs. However, many are unfamiliar with just how far-reaching these benefits can be — or how to apply for them effectively.

Spouses and dependents of veterans, particularly widows, also require assistance and acknowledgment. There are programs aimed at providing aid for widows of veterans, ranging from ongoing financial support to schooling benefits and death benefits. Similarly, veterans' dependents may qualify for support tailored to their needs — including wellness protection, education grants, and more.

As America’s senior population continues to grow, another area of concern is access to Medicaid and Medicare assistance for seniors. For many older adults, these programs are essential benefits — providing access to treatment, long-term support, and pharmaceuticals. Navigating them, however, isn’t always simple, and having the right partner in the process makes all the difference.
